Работа с большими числами или, наоборот, с очень маленькими величинами в табличном процессоре часто приводит к тому, что пользователи видят в ячейках странную запись, содержащую букву Е. Многие начинающие пользователи Microsoft Excel пугаются, думая, что допустили ошибку или что программа повреждена. На самом деле, это стандартный способ отображения чисел, известный как экспоненциальный формат.
Буква Е в данном контексте является сокращением от слова "Exponent" (показатель степени) и означает умножение числа перед ней на 10 в степени, указанной после знака. Например, запись 5E+03 эквивалентна числу 5000. Понимание того, как в Экселе пишется Е и как управлять этим форматом, критически важно для корректного отображения финансовых отчетов и научных данных.
В этой статье мы подробно разберем механику работы экспоненциальной записи, способы принудительного ввода таких чисел и методы их преобразования в привычный десятичный вид. Вы научитесь контролировать отображение данных и избегать распространенных ошибок при работе с числовыми массивами.
Механика экспоненциального формата
Когда вы вводите в ячейку очень большое число, например, 123456789012, программа автоматически может переключить формат отображения на научный. В этом случае вы увидите значение вроде 1,23E+11. Это не ошибка округления, а способ экономии места в ячейке, который позволяет сохранить значение числа без потери точности в памяти программы.
Разберем структуру такой записи подробнее. Число перед буквой Е называется мантиссой, а число после знака плюс или минус — порядком. Знак после буквы Е указывает направление смещения десятичной запятой: плюс означает движение вправо (увеличение числа), а минус — влево (уменьшение числа, работа с долями).
Важно понимать, что внутреннее хранение значения в Excel остается неизменным, меняется только визуальная оболочка. Система продолжает считать это число обычным числовым значением, с которым можно выполнять любые арифметические операции. Проблемы возникают лишь тогда, когда требуется текстовое представление или точное совпадение формата с внешними документами.
⚠️ Внимание: При копировании данных из ячейки с экспоненциальным форматом в текстовый редактор или другую программу, запись может автоматически конвертироваться в обычное число. Если вам нужно сохранить именно вид "1.23E+11", ячейку необходимо предварительно отформатировать как текст.
Автоматическое переключение формата часто происходит при вводе чисел, содержащих более 11 знаков. Однако пороговое значение может зависеть от ширины столбца: если ячейка узкая, Excel может применить научный стиль отображения даже для меньших чисел, чтобы они поместились в отведенное пространство.
Как вручную ввести число с экспонентой
Иногда возникает необходимость explicitly указать программе, что число должно быть записано в экспоненциальном формате. Для этого используется специальный синтаксис ввода. Вы можете напрямую ввести значение, используя букву Е (или е, регистр не важен) как разделитель между мантиссой и показателем степени.
Для ввода числа 5000 в экспоненциальной форме достаточно написать в ячейке 5E3 и нажать Enter. Программа мгновенно распознает эту конструкцию и, в зависимости от настроек формата ячейки, либо оставит запись как есть, либо пересчитает и отобразит обычное число 5000. Если же вам нужно, чтобы в ячейке визуально осталось именно "5E3", необходимо заранее изменить формат ячейки на Текстовый.
Рассмотрим алгоритм ввода таких данных пошагово:
- 🔢 Выделите ячейку, куда планируете ввести данные.
- ⌨️ Наберите число, затем букву Е, затем знак степени (+ или -) и само значение степени.
- ✅ Нажмите Enter для фиксации ввода.
Стоит отметить, что при вводе данных таким способом Excel автоматически присваивает ячейке Общий числовой формат. Если вы введете 1E-3, в ячейке отобразится 0,001. Чтобы увидеть именно экспоненциальную запись, нужно изменить формат ячейки через меню свойств.
Преобразование экспоненты в обычный числовой вид
Часто пользователи сталкиваются с обратной задачей: данные уже загружены в таблицу в виде 1,25E+06, а их нужно привести к виду 1 250 000 для печати или передачи контрагентам. Сделать это можно через изменение числового формата без потери данных.
Для выполнения конвертации выделите проблемный диапазон ячеек. Нажмите правую кнопку мыши и выберите пункт Формат ячеек (или используйте горячие клавиши Ctrl+1). В открывшемся окне перейдите на вкладку Число и выберите категорию Числовой.
В правой части окна настройте количество десятичных знаков. Если вам нужны целые числа, установите значение 0. Если важны доли, укажите необходимое количество знаков после запятой. После нажатия кнопки ОК все выделенные ячейки примут стандартный десятичный вид.
☑️ Проверка формата ячеек
Существует также быстрый способ через панель инструментов на вкладке Главная. В блоке "Число" есть выпадающий список, где можно выбрать "Числовой формат". Также там доступны кнопки для быстрого увеличения или уменьшения разрядности, что позволяет мгновенно убрать или добавить знаки после запятой.
| Запись в ячейке | Математическое значение | Обычный вид (пример) | Описание |
|---|---|---|---|
| 3E+2 | 3 * 102 | 300 | Три сотни |
| 1,5E+3 | 1,5 * 103 | 1 500 | Полторы тысячи |
| 4E-2 | 4 * 10-2 | 0,04 | Четыре сотых |
| 2,5E-4 | 2,5 * 10-4 | 0,00025 | Двести пятьдесят миллионных |
Работа с очень малыми и очень большими числами
В научных и инженерных расчетах часто приходится оперировать величинами, которые в обычном формате заняли бы слишком много места. Например, расстояние до звезд или размер атома. В таких случаях экспоненциальная запись становится не просто удобной, а необходимой.
Excel поддерживает работу с числами огромной размерности. Предел точности составляет 15 значащих цифр. Если вы введете число, содержащее больше 15 знаков, все знаки после 15-го будут заменены нулями. Это ограничение связано со стандартом вычислений с плавающей запятой.
При работе с такими данными важно следить за форматированием, чтобы не потерять визуальную информацию о масштабе. Использование Научного формата (Scientific) позволяет стандартизировать отображение всех чисел в столбце, приводя их к единому виду с одинаковым количеством знаков после запятой в мантиссе.
Что делать, если число обрезалось?
Если вы видите, что последние цифры числа заменились на нули (например, номер кредитной карты или длинный ID), значит, число превысило лимит в 15 знаков. Для хранения таких данных (более 15 цифр) обязательно используйте Текстовый формат ячейки перед вводом, поставив перед числом апостроф ' или выбрав формат "Текстовый" в меню.
Для настройки специального научного формата:
- 🔬 Откройте
Формат ячеек. - 📊 Выберите категорию Научный.
- 🔢 Укажите требуемое количество десятичных знаков.
Такой подход обеспечивает единообразие документации. Например, все числа в отчете будут выглядеть как 1,23E+05, что упрощает визуальное сравнение порядков величин.
Типичные ошибки и их решение
Одной из самых распространенных проблем является неожиданное округление. Пользователь вводит длинное число, а получает в ответ набор нулей. Это происходит потому, что Excel по умолчанию считает, что вы вводите число, а не текст, и применяет правило 15 знаков.
Еще одна частая ошибка — попытка математических операций с текстовыми представлениями экспонент. Если ячейка отформатирована как текст и содержит "5E3", функция СУММ проигнорирует её. В этом случае необходимо предварительно преобразовать текст в число, используя функцию ЗНАЧЕН или инструмент "Текст по столбцам".
⚠️ Внимание: При импорте данных из CSV или текстовых файлов длинные числовые коды (например, штрих-коды) часто превращаются в экспоненциальный вид и теряют точность. Всегда используйте мастер импорта и указывайте формат столбца как "Текстовый" на этапе загрузки.
Если вы столкнулись с ошибкой #ЗНАЧ! при попытке изменить формат, проверьте, нет ли в ячейке лишних пробелов или непечатаемых символов. Очистка данных функцией ПЕЧСИМВ часто помогает исправить ситуацию.
Использование функций для работы с экспонентой
Для программной записи чисел в экспоненциальном формате в Excel существует специальная функция ТЕКСТ. Она позволяет преобразовать числовое значение в строку с заданным форматом. Это полезно при создании отчетов, где нужно concatenировать числа с другим текстом.
Синтаксис функции выглядит следующим образом: =ТЕКСТ(число; "формат"). Для получения экспоненциальной записи в качестве формата используется код "0,00E+00". Количество нулей после запятой определяет количество отображаемых знаков.
=ТЕКСТ(A1; "0,00E+00")
Эта формула превратит число из ячейки A1 в текстовую строку вида "1,23E+04". Обратите внимание, что результат будет текстом, и использовать его в дальнейших вычислениях без предварительного преобразования обратно в число уже не получится.
Также для анализа порядка числа можно использовать логарифмические функции. Функция LOG10 поможет определить степень числа, что эквивалентно значению после буквы Е в научной записи.
FAQ: Часто задаваемые вопросы
Почему Excel сам меняет мои числа на формат с буквой Е?
Это происходит, когда число содержит более 11 знаков или когда ширина ячейки слишком мала для отображения полного числа в обычном формате. Программа автоматически переключается на научный стиль, чтобы данные не отображались как решетки (#####).
Можно ли полностью отключить автоматическую экспоненту?
Глобально отключить эту функцию в настройках Excel нельзя, так как это системное поведение. Однако вы можете заранее форматировать ячейки как Текстовые или Числовые с фиксированным количеством знаков, что предотвратит автоматическое переключение на научный формат для чисел в допустимых пределах.
Что означает Е- в записи числа?
Запись Е- означает отрицательную степень десятки. Это используется для отображения очень малых дробных чисел. Например, 2E-3 равно 0,002 (две тысячных). Знак минус указывает на то, что десятичную запятую нужно сдвинуть влево.
Как сделать, чтобы при печати отображались обычные числа?
Для печати необходимо изменить формат ячеек на Числовой и настроить количество знаков после запятой. Научный формат при печати сохранится, если не изменить настройки отображения. Убедитесь, что в предпросмотре печати числа выглядят корректно.